🎬 Title: Josephine

Story: Eight-year-old Josephine becomes a witness to a crime in Golden Gate Park, leading her to exhibit violent behavior as a means of self-protection. This traumatic experience creates tension within her family as her parents strive to seek justice and find a sense of safety for their daughter.
